The Convenience and Efficiency of Dumpster Rental

Structured Waste Management: One of the most significant benefits of leasing a dumpster is the streamlining of waste management. Instead of making several trips to a land fill or waste disposal site, a rented dumpster permits you to combine all your waste in one central area. This not just conserves precious effort and time but also minimizes your carbon footprint by lowering transportation emissions.

Time and Labor Savings: Think about the time and physical labor required to pack your car with garbage, drive to the dump, wait in line, and unload your waste. Dumpster rental eliminates these troubles, permitting you to focus on your project while experts handle waste elimination.

Cost-Efficiency: Surprisingly, leasing a dumpster frequently proves to be more cost-effective in the long run. When you consider costs like fuel, disposal fees, and lorry upkeep, choosing a dumpster rental makes monetary sense.

Improved Safety: Dumpster rental contributes to security at your worksite or residential or commercial property. By keeping waste contained within a safe and secure dumpster, you minimize the risk of mishaps, such as tripping over debris or direct exposure to hazardous products.

Variety of Sizes: Dumpster rental business offer a variety of dumpster sizes to accommodate different tasks. Whether you require a compact dumpster for a weekend clean-up or a substantial one for a building and construction site, you can discover the perfect size to match your requirements.

Ecological Responsibility: Responsible garbage disposal is crucial for ecological conservation. Dumpster rental companies are skilled in disposing of waste in accordance with local regulations and environmental standards. They ensure recyclable products are separated and that contaminated materials is gotten rid of correctly.

Maintaining a Clean and Organized Worksite: A chaotic worksite can hinder efficiency and increase the threat of accidents. Renting a dumpster helps keep your task location clean and organized, cultivating more effective operations.

What Should Never Go Into a Dumpster

While dumpster rental provides numerous advantages, it is similarly essential to know products that need to never find their way into a dumpster. Failure to abide by proper disposal guidelines can result in fines, environmental damage, and security threats. Here's a list of products you should never toss into a rented dumpster:

Hazardous Materials: This category consists of chemicals, paints, solvents, batteries, and other products that can posture ecological and safety dangers. Contaminated materials should be gotten rid of through specialized programs or centers.

Electronic devices: Old tvs, computer systems, and electronic gadgets consist of damaging compounds like lead and mercury. Recycling or contributing these products is the accountable option.

Tires: Tires are normally declined in dumpsters due to their bulk and possible ecological damage. Numerous automobile stores and recycling centers accept old tires for appropriate disposal.

Big Appliances: Refrigerators, stoves, washing machines, and other large appliances often consist of refrigerants and other compounds needing specialized disposal. Talk to local recycling programs for suitable options.

Mattresses: Mattresses and box springs are challenging to compact and take in substantial area in a dumpster. A lot of dumpster rental companies have specific standards for getting rid of these products.

Lawn Waste: Grass clippings, branches, leaves, and other yard waste should not be blended with other garbage. Numerous municipalities use different lawn waste collection or composting services.

Concrete and Bricks: Dumpsters are not suitable for heavy building and construction particles. Separate containers or recycling centers are better options for concrete, bricks, and other building and construction products.

Flammable Materials: Items like fuel, lp tanks, and fireworks can result in dangerous scenarios if put in a dumpster. These items need to be dealt with following local guidelines.

Medical Waste: Sharps, prescription medications, and other medical waste require disposal through licensed medical waste disposal services.

Asbestos: Asbestos-containing products are highly hazardous and need professional removal and disposal.
